YONKERS, NY ~ Yonkers Mayor Mike Spano has announced three convenient locations for Yonkers residents to pay their City property taxes. The Mayor's Office of Constituent Services and the City's Finance Department will be available on December 28th, January 3rd, and January 4th from 9AM to 7PM at Homefield House, Coyne Park/Bernice Spreckman Community Center, and Grinton I. Will Library respectively. All City property tax payments are due by Monday, January 8th.

Mayor Spano said, "As a way to make it easier for residents to pay their property taxes or water bills and use city services, I am once again offering the Mobile Tax Office to everyone. I invite those who need assistance with any issue or need access to a location close to home to stop by any of the three locations."
Residents who need assistance can contact the Office of Constituent Services at (914) 377-6010 between 9:00 AM - 4:30 PM or contact the 24/7 Mayor's Help Line at 377-HELP (4357).
